DescriptionCVE.org

The application does not properly validate the lifetime and validity of internal view cache pointers after JavaScript changes the document zoom and page state. When a script modifies the zoom property and then triggers a page change, the original view object may be destroyed while stale pointers are still kept and later dereferenced, which under crafted JavaScript and document structures can lead to a use-after-free condition and potentially allow arbitrary code execution.

AnalysisAI

Use-after-free in Foxit PDF Editor and Foxit PDF Reader allows local attackers to achieve arbitrary code execution by crafting malicious JavaScript that manipulates document zoom and page state, causing stale view cache pointers to be dereferenced after the underlying view object is destroyed. The vulnerability requires user interaction (opening a crafted PDF) and local access, with a CVSS score of 5.5 reflecting denial-of-service impact, though the underlying memory corruption (CWE-416) and RCE tags indicate higher real-world severity under exploitation.

Technical ContextAI

The vulnerability exists in Foxit's PDF rendering engine's internal view cache management system. When JavaScript embedded in a PDF document modifies the zoom property (via document.zoom or similar APIs) and subsequently triggers a page state change, the application fails to properly validate the lifetime of cached view pointers. This leads to a use-after-free condition (CWE-416) where freed memory locations are subsequently dereferenced. The affected CPE strings indicate both Foxit PDF Editor (a full-featured PDF authoring tool) and Foxit PDF Reader (the lightweight viewer) contain this flaw, suggesting the vulnerability resides in a shared core rendering library used by both products.

RemediationAI

Users should immediately check the Foxit security bulletins page at https://www.foxit.com/support/security-bulletins.html for the latest patched versions of Foxit PDF Editor and Foxit PDF Reader. Patch availability and specific fixed versions should be confirmed from Foxit's official advisory. Until a patch can be applied, avoid opening untrusted PDF documents from external sources, particularly those containing embedded JavaScript, and consider disabling JavaScript execution in PDF reader settings if the application permits this configuration.
